Material Notes:
Vydyne® 41 NT is general-purpose, impact-modified PA66 resin. Available in natural, it is recognized for all the processing and property advantages inherent to PA66 with the addition of improved impact strength. This resin offers a well balanced combination of engineering properties characterized by high melt point, good surface lubricity, abrasion resistance and resistance to many chemicals, machine and motor oils, solvents and gasoline. Vydyne 41 NT is designed to meet the critical low-temperature impact requirements called out in many automotive specifications. Typical Applications/End Uses: Vydyne 41 NT may be used in both industrial and automotive applications. Typical end uses include: clips, fasteners, engine gearing, cable ties, electrical connectors and many other parts that require high-impact properties. Vydyne 41 NT resin can in many cases be used as a metal replacement, offering improvements on abrasion resistance, reduction in part weight, greater processing flexibility and lower energy consumption.
